I walk around the perimeter of Desert Breeze park about 4 to 5 times a week. I Like to watch the sporting events going on and the Lake is very calming to walk around. But I have been getting more and more frustrated as I walked the perimeter and see all of the places where plants used to be. You can spot them very easily because even though the plants haven't been there for several years, those locations are still being watered. When I walk the perimeter of the entire park I count 185 locations where there used to be a Bush or a Tree, where water is still being dispersed on a regular basis, just to evaporate into oblivion. I have added circle pictures showing the barren landscape. We, the citizens of Chandler, paid good money for those plants but the city didn't pay good money to have them maintained. Maintaining those plants should be a Mandate by whoever is the supervisor in charge of park maintenance and upkeep. I visit some of the other parks and they look beautiful with well maintained landscaping and I am ashamed that my park, Desert Breeze, is just left on the wayside and not maintained. I'm going to start posting pictures of all of the Large areas where plants used to be, where there are only 2 or 3 now and there used to be 20 to 25 in the same area. I want to start shaming are counsel people for letting this waste happen. Get off your burrs and walk the park. See the wasted appropriation $$. I have a happy solution that I think would be a nice community project. Mark all of the locations where a plant used to be and allow citizens to bring their own plants in and get reimbursed up to $20 for bringing in a plant and let us plant in every location where there's water still watering that area. I think it would be a great springtime project for the whole community. I'm sure we we even get the big Box stores to donate the plants. Putting a new plant in the ground is easy, maintaining it requires constant attention and the city needs to hire a proper people to maintain the beauty...

Big park to play at. Can go fishing in the ponds--we didn't, but it's nice to have that opportunity.

We primarily went for the train and carousel ride. Only downfall was there was one ride operator. What does that mean? Well, the person driving the train is the one that operates the carousel.

So the train was scheduled for every 1/2 hour. I believe the train was about an 11-15 minute ride, gives the operator a chance to unload and say his goodbyes getting the train and then hustle over to the carousel to let people on. Operate the carousel, say his goodbyes, then hustle back to the train.

We got off the train to go on the carousel. Carousel had no operator. We stood waiting, but another guy came out and didn't operate the carousel.. He went to the train. So we went back there. The main operator was nice and friendly (big dude with the eloquent, booming voice). I do believe he was on a break when the other person came out. He was not in a uniform and we did not understand his speech. He rushed so fast it was incomprehensible. Turns out this guy who was rushing through the speech for the train ride, my mother witnessed him messing around in the kitchen. He got ketchup in another (female) employee's hair. Then this female was complaining (with every right), but it was all seen through the window. She was trying to get the ketchup out of her hair while in the kitchen... Ummm, what kind of food and sanitation laws does Arizona have? 🤢

Another thing, another employee that was handling money for tickets/wristbands was also handling food... No gloves, just her bare hands. Seriously, that's disgusting.

Also, girl with blue hair, there was no need to speed through the train ride. Good grief.

We were there for the rides, but it needs to be known what was happening. I understand it's a fun place, but the employees should act...
